Name: JENKINS, Edward Vaughan DSO (Major)

image of individual

Nee: son of Lieut.-Colonel Vaughan Jenkins

Birth Date: 14.10.1879 Lucknow

Death Date: 20.2.1941 Bolney, Sussex

Nationality: British

First Date: 1902

Profession: KAR; Uganda Railway official

Area: EAHB 1906 Kericho

Married: 1. In Sevenoaks 1904 Evelyn Marie Germon bapt. 10 May 1878 Brighton; 2. Mary Kathleen

Book Reference: Gillett, Cuckoo, Sitrep 6, Police, Moyse, Debrett, EAHB 1905, North, EA Diary 1903, Drumkey, EAHB 1906, Harmony, DSO, EAHB 1904, EAHB 1907

War Service: West Riding Regt.

School: Clifton College

General Information:

Sitrep 6 - Africa General Service Medal 1902-56 - East Africa 1905 - This clasp was awarded for two expeditions; the first under Major L.R.H. Pope-Hennessy, DSO (OXLI) to Sotik - 1905; the second under Capt. E.V. Jenkins DSO (DWR) to Kisii - 1905.
Police - In 1904 a small body of Police under Sergeant-Instructor J.H. Milton was attached to a Company of the KAR, commanded by Captain (later Lieut.-Col) E.V. Jenkins, DSO, which dealt successfully with a revolt of the Kisii in the Kisumu (later Nyanza) Province and for this the EA General Service Medal with a bar (Kisii, 1904) was also issued.  
Moyse - led a punitive expedition against the Kisii in 1905  
Debrett- entered Duke of Wellington's (W. Riding Regt.) 1899, became Capt 1904, and Major 1919; retired 1920; now Major Reserve of Officers; S. Africa 1899-1902, present at relief of Kimberley, and battles of Paardeberg, Driefontein, and Rhenoster Kop (despatches, Queen's medal with 4 clasps, King's medal with 2 clasps, DSO), with Nandi Expedition 1905-6 (despatches, medal with 2 clasps) European War 1914; was Comdt. 4th Batn. of KAR 1902-12
North - Uganda Mil. - Uganda Railway later Member of Lodge Harmony - Joined 7/11/10, age 32, Soldier, Kampala
DSO - London Gazette 27/9/1901 - In recognition of services during the operations in South Africa. He was promoted Lieut. 19 Feb 1900; was employed with the KAR 22 Apr 1902 to 21 April 1912; became Captain 15 Apr 1904; served in East Africa 1905 in command of an expedition (Despatches) ; served at Nandi 1905-6 (Medal with 2 clasps) ……
Cuckoo - 1904 - Sent with a company of the 3rd KAR and a machine gun detachment to Kisumu, with orders to go into the unadministered Kisii country and restore order among the wild tribesmen. (Duke of Wellington's Own).
